How Can Parents Ensure the Right Size and Fit for Their Child’s Cleats?

Parents can ensure the right size and fit for their child’s cleats by measuring their child’s foot, considering the type of sport, allowing for growth, and checking the fit in-store or online.

  1. Measure the foot: Use a ruler or a foot measuring device to find the exact length and width. Children’s feet grow quickly, so measuring regularly is important.
  2. Consider the type of sport: Different sports have different cleat designs. For example, soccer cleats have distinct stud shapes for traction on grass, while baseball cleats might have a toe spike. Choose cleats specifically designed for the sport to ensure optimal performance.
  3. Allow for growth: Children’s feet can grow several sizes in a year. Leave a thumb’s width of space between the end of the toe and the front of the cleat. This allows for comfort and movement as the child grows.
  4. Try them on: If possible, have the child wear the cleats and walk around in them. Look for any areas of discomfort. Children should wear the socks they’ll use during play to test the fit accurately.
  5. Check for proper snugness: The heel should fit securely without slipping. The sides should feel snug but not overly tight. Ensuring a proper fit will help prevent blisters and other foot injuries.
  6. Research brand sizing: Different brands may have varying sizing charts. Check these before purchasing to find the best fit. For example, Nike cleats may run smaller than Adidas, which could affect selection.

By following these guidelines, parents can reduce the risk of foot problems and improve their child’s athletic performance.

What Maintenance Tips Can Help Extend the Life of Youth Baseball Cleats?

The following maintenance tips can help extend the life of youth baseball cleats:

  1. Clean after use
  2. Dry properly
  3. Store correctly
  4. Inspect regularly
  5. Replace worn-out parts

Maintaining youth baseball cleats is essential for performance and longevity. Each tip addresses key aspects that significantly impact the cleats’ condition and usability.

  1. Clean after use: Cleaning baseball cleats after each use helps remove dirt, mud, and grass that can degrade materials. This process involves wiping down the exterior with a damp cloth and, if needed, using a mild soap solution for deeper cleaning. According to the American Orthopedic Foot & Ankle Society, regular cleaning can prevent material breakdown and odors, which prolongs the footwear’s life.

  2. Dry properly: Proper drying is crucial to maintaining cleats. After cleaning or use in wet conditions, remove the insoles and laces. Allow cleats to air dry at room temperature away from direct sunlight and heat sources, as these can warp materials. The National Athletic Trainers’ Association emphasizes that improper drying can lead to mold growth and material stiffness.

  3. Store correctly: Storing cleats in a cool, dry place helps prevent moisture accumulation and damage. Use a ventilated shoe box or breathable bag. The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ission advises against leaving cleats in hot, humid environments, which can lead to deformation and spoilage of the cleat materials.

  4. Inspect regularly: Regular inspections for wear and tear help identify issues early. Check the soles for loose or missing spikes, and inspect the material for signs of cracking or separation. A study by the Journal of Sports Sciences indicates that proactive maintenance can prevent injuries, as worn cleats may impede grip and stability.

  5. Replace worn-out parts: Replacing cleats or components, such as insoles and spikes, when showing signs of excessive wear can extend their functional life. The Athletic Footwear Association highlights that appropriate replacement maintains optimal performance and reduces injury risk.

These maintenance strategies collectively support the cleats’ endurance, emphasizing the importance of care in enhancing the life of youth baseball footwear.
